What is electrical energy?

Electrical energy is the energy generated by the movement of electric charges, typically in the form of electrons, through a conductor. It is a fundamental form of energy that powers a vast array of technologies and is essential for daily operations.

What exactly is an electrician?

An electrician is a skilled tradesperson who specializes in the installation, maintenance, and repair of electrical systems. They work with wiring, circuit breakers, lighting, and other electrical components to ensure safe and efficient power distribution.

Do electricians do HVAC?

Electricians are responsible for the electrical components that enable HVAC systems to function. This includes wiring, circuit protection, and control system integration, ensuring that heating, ventilation, and air conditioning units operate safely and effectively.
